Not possible to cancel TSVN when it scans directories for changes
Hi,
when I do TSVN commit on a large directory structure and I want to
cancel it, I've to wait until TSVN is finished scanning all directories.
The cancel button is even grayed out and clicking on the close button
[X] doesn't do anything.
Can this be enabled?
